Housekeeping Dispatch primarily focuses on coordinating and scheduling housekeeping staff, often working behind the scenes. In contrast, Housekeeping Supervisors oversee daily operations, supervise staff, and ensure quality standards. While dispatch roles require strong communication skills, supervisors need leadership experience. Both roles are essential in maintaining efficient housekeeping services within similar industries.
